Signal processing for a receiver, such as a radio receiver within a cellular telephone, includes providing frequency conversion, preferentially passing a desired signal following the conversion, and introducing both phase-based filtering and equalization to the band-filtered signal. In one embodiment, the band filtering is provided by a low pass filter and the compensation occurs following operations by a polyphase filter, which implements the phase-based filtering. In many applications, the frequency conversion is a down conversion to either a zero intermediate frequency or a low intermediate frequency. The low pass filter reduces out-of-band interference and blocking signal strength, but may introduce phase-related distortions. The polyphase filtering and equalization cooperate to control the phase-related distortions.
